Buying Semiconductor Lasers

Top-level product category: lasers and laser amplifiers

More general product categories: lasers

More specific product categories: diode lasers, laser diodes, quantum cascade lasers, surface-emitting semiconductor lasers

Semiconductor lasers encompass various types, with laser diodes being the most common. Additionally, there are optically pumped surface-emitting lasers (VECSELs) and quantum cascade lasers, each offering unique advantages for specific applications. These lasers are integral to modern photonics, providing high efficiency and versatility for communications, sensing, and industrial processes.

Aspects to Consider Before Buying

Some aspects to consider before buying semiconductor lasers: output power, wavelength, continuous or pulsed emission, power efficiency, beam forming options, beam quality, laser noise, thermal management, modulation capability, integration flexibility, feedback sensitivity, environmental stability, reliability.

SHIPS TODAY: AeroDIODE offers fiber-coupled laser diodes between 520 nm and 1650 nm as stock items or associated with a CW laser diode driver or pulsed laser diode driver. They are compatible with our high speed nanosecond pulsed drivers or high power CW drivers with air cooling for the multimode high power laser diode versions. The single mode laser diodes (either Fabry–Pérot laser diode or DFB laser diode) can reach high power in nanosecond pulse regime up to 500 mW. Most turn-key diode & driver solutions are optimized for single-shot to CW performances with pulse width lengths down to 1 ns. The laser diode precision pulses are generated internally by an on-board pulse generator, or on demand from an external TTL signal. Many multimode versions are available with CW emission up to 300 W in a 200-µm core multimode fiber or up to 250 W in a 135-µm core fiber or 160 W in a 105 µm core fiber.
